Goods and services

ClassDescriptionStatusFirst use
009Computer software platforms for implementing blockchain processes; computer software, namely, open source operating software for the use of a cryptocurrency on a global computer network; software to facilitate the use of a blockchain or distributed ledger to execute and record financial transactions, including trades, in connection with the use of a cryptocurrency; computer software for developing, deploying, and managing applications, integrating applications, data, and services all for use of a cryptocurrencyACTIVENov 9, 2021
036Financial services, namely, providing a virtual, digital and cryptocurrency currency for use by members of an on-line community via a global computer network; financial services, namely, virtual, digital and cryptocurrency exchange transaction services for transferrable electronic cash equivalent units having a specified cash value; financial cash management, namely, facilitating and tracking transfers of electronic cash equivalents; virtual, digital and cryptocurrency currency exchange transaction services for transferrable electronic cash equivalent units having a specified cash value; financial services, namely, electronic funds transfer via electronic communications networks; financial exchange services; virtual, digital and cryptocurrency monetary exchange services; financial services, namely, providing a decentralized and open source cryptocurrency on a global computer network utilizing a blockchain; downloadable databases in the field of digital assets, namely, virtual currency exchange information and statistics, social networking records, blog posts and statistics relating to virtual currencyACTIVENov 9, 2021
042Providing on-line non-downloadable computer software for use as a cryptocurrency wallet; Software as a Service (SaaS) services featuring software for blockchain technology and distributed ledger technologyACTIVENov 9, 2021
